Output 04dc2ddc81a1d85f0df31569105e3bdd4d07bc9b1567cf0aee53a1908f2e2fad:12

value
43999131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bdfdeb5842ffd177340151464552ea7c11c766c OP_EQUAL
address
MSV9b8SVWAqZZ9j78vPws2qgm8chaNfbke
transaction
04dc2ddc81a1d85f0df31569105e3bdd4d07bc9b1567cf0aee53a1908f2e2fad
spent
true